Project Stormfury - Hypothesis

Hypothesis

Cloud seeding was first attempted by Vincent Schaefer and Irving Langmuir. After witnessing the artificial creation of ice crystals, Langmuir became an enthusiastic proponent of weather modification. Schaefer found that when he dumped crushed dry ice into a cloud, precipitation in the form of snow resulted.

With regard to hurricanes, it was hypothesized that by seeding the area around the eyewall with silver iodide, latent heat would be released. This would promote the formation of a new eyewall. As this new eyewall was larger than the old eyewall, the winds of the tropical cyclone would be weaker due to a reduced pressure gradient. Even a small reduction in the speed of a hurricane's winds would be beneficial; as the damage potential of a hurricane increased as the square of the wind speed, a slight lowering of wind speed would have a large reduction in destructiveness.

Due to Langmuir's efforts, and the research of Schaefer at General Electric, the concept of using cloud seeding to weaken hurricanes gathered momentum. Indeed, Schaefer had caused a major snowstorm on December 20, 1946 by seeding a cloud. This caused GE to drop out for legal reasons. Schaefer and Langmuir assisted the U.S. military as advisors for Project Cirrus, the first large study of cloud physics and weather modification. Its most important goal was to try to weaken hurricanes.
